Ebony Northeast is a Melbourne-based fashion designer whose work is defined by the beauty of fabric textiles, architectural silhouettes and nature’s elements. Her garments explore the tension between structure and softness, texture and patterns. Growing up in a small town in the Northern Rivers region of Australia, fashion became a vessel for personal exploration and expression. Ebony sees fashion as a form of communication, a way
to show who you are and how you can envision different concepts. Her rural upbringing has helped her develop an appreciation for nature and the beauty of sustainable processes as she priorities slow fashion. Throughout her graduate year, the collection’s foundation is defined by the innovative use of merino wool and her unique textile manipulation methods; this authentic approach was recognised and awarded with an Australian Wool Educational Trust Grant.
Concept
Veil of Time is a womenswear collection that explores the tension between permanence and erosion, using weathered statues as a metaphor for the beauty found in ageing. Inspired by classical sculptures slowly transformed by time and the elements, the collection embraces imperfection, wear, and gradual transformation, acknowledging how forms can change drastically while still retaining their elegance. The muted palette draws from sand dune landscapes, with soft beige and orange tones evoking serenity and timelessness. Fabrics are selected and manipulated to reflect textured surfaces touched by age, creating garments that feel sculptural and lived-in.
Draping and fabric manipulation sit at the core of the design approach, echoing the flowing marble robes seen on ancient statues. Wool felting is used to sculpt organic, softened forms that mimic natural erosion, while crochet introduces delicate layers of hand-crafted texture. Together, these techniques create surfaces that feel both fragile and enduring. The collection draws inspiration from designers who explore the experimentation of materials and form: Issey Miyake’s textile innovation, Uma Wang’s layered and tactile aesthetic, and Robert Wun’s sculptural approach to womenswear. Veil of Time merges fluidity with structure, creating garments that exist between art and fashion.
